Transaction c89ef2b1521e530e2940f6ed9131cdabf6f15d24df286a814abd0fc63a2eb793
1 Input
1 Output
-
c89ef2b1521e530e2940f6ed9131cdabf6f15d24df286a814abd0fc63a2eb793:0
- value
- 64683959
- script pubkey
- OP_0 OP_PUSHBYTES_20 36b12cdff4ee0af9cbb94155cdcedb3c32263e19
- address
- bc1qx6cjehl5ac90njaeg92umnkm8sezv0secln9f3